Michigan Preview: Will the Wolverines Show Any Form of Life?
Michigan closed at 8-23 after losing to Nebraska in Lincoln, 85-70. The Wolverines were outscored in both halves by the Cornhuskers, and it’s unclear how they’ll come out here in Minneapolis. Michigan is scoring 75.2 points per game, on 45.3% shooting, while allowing 78.8 ppg, and they’re 2-8 over their previous ten games.
Michigan Team Profile
- Juwan Howard’s team plays at a solid pace, averaging 73.2 possessions per game (111th), and they’ve shot well from deep, connecting on 36.2% of their three-point attempts (61st).
- Sophomore guard Dug McDaniel scored 17 points or more in three of the final four games, and he leads Michigan in scoring (16.6) and assists (4.6).
- Tennessee transfer Olivier Nkamhoua leads the Wolverines in rebounding (7.1), but he's missed the last five games.

Penn State Preview: Nittany Lions in Managable Spot to Advance
Penn State finished at 15-16 after defeating Maryland at home, 85-69. The Nittany Lions pulled away from the Terps in the second period, and they’ll try to replicate those results here against the Wolverines. PSU is scoring 75.6 points per game, on 44.3% shooting, while allowing 74.8 ppg, and they’re 5-5 over their previous ten games.
Penn State Team Profile
- Mike Rhoades’ team has been forced to slow things down here in league action, averaging 73.5 possessions per game (74th), and they’ve shot 33.6% from the outside.
- VCU transfer Ace Baldwin Jr. went for a team-high 23 points in the Indiana victory, and he leads the Nittany Lions in assists (5.9), while scoring 14.2 ppg.
- Former Georgetown big Qudus Wahab led the way with 18 points in the Iowa matchup, and he leads PSU in rebounding (7.5), while scoring 9.5 ppg.
